SMILE Eye Surgical Procedure Introduction



If you're thinking about SMILE eye surgical procedure, you'll locate it to be a minimally invasive procedure with a quick healing time. Throughout SMILE (Small Laceration Lenticule Extraction), a laser is utilized to produce a small, accurate incision in the cornea to eliminate a tiny piece of cells, reshaping it to remedy your vision. Among the essential benefits of SMILE is its minimally intrusive nature, leading to a faster healing procedure and less discomfort post-surgery. The recovery time for SMILE is fairly quick, with numerous people experiencing improved vision within a day or two. This makes it a prominent selection for those looking for a practical and effective vision modification treatment. In addition, SMILE has actually been revealed to have a lower danger of completely dry eye disorder contrasted to LASIK, making it a beneficial option for people worried concerning this prospective negative effects.

Distinctions In Between SMILE, LASIK, and PRK



When comparing SMILE, LASIK, and PRK eye surgical treatments, it's important to understand the unique techniques used in each procedure for vision correction.

SMILE (Tiny Cut Lenticule Removal) is a minimally intrusive procedure that entails producing a little cut to extract a lenticule from the cornea, reshaping it to correct vision.

LASIK (Laser-Assisted Sitting Keratomileusis) involves developing a thin flap on the cornea, utilizing a laser to improve the underlying tissue, and after that rearranging the flap.

PRK (Photorefractive Keratectomy) eliminates the external layer of the cornea prior to reshaping the tissue with a laser.

The major difference depends on the method the cornea is accessed and dealt with. SMILE is flapless, making it an excellent alternative for people with thin corneas or those involved in call sports. LASIK supplies rapid aesthetic recovery due to the flap development, yet it might posture a greater risk of flap-related complications. PRK, although having a longer recovery duration, avoids flap-related problems altogether.

Understanding these variations is vital in selecting one of the most ideal treatment for your vision correction needs.

Advantages And Disadvantages Contrast



To assess the benefits and drawbacks of SMILE, LASIK, and PRK eye surgical treatments, it's necessary to consider the certain benefits and prospective restrictions of each treatment. Nevertheless, SMILE may have restrictions in dealing with greater levels of nearsightedness or astigmatism contrasted to LASIK.

LASIK surgery provides quick aesthetic healing and very little pain throughout the procedure. It's extremely efficient in dealing with a variety of refractive errors, including myopia, hyperopia, and astigmatism. Yet, LASIK carries a danger of flap complications, which can impact the corneal structure.

PRK eye surgical procedure, while not as preferred as LASIK, prevents developing a corneal flap, reducing the threat of flap-related issues. It appropriates for people with thin corneas or irregular corneal surfaces. Nonetheless, PRK has a much longer healing time and may involve extra discomfort throughout the recovery procedure.
